Hyposecretion of GH in children cause what?

Hyposecretion of growth hormone (GH) in children leads to growth disorders, primarily resulting in short stature or dwarfism. This condition, known as growth hormone deficiency, can also affect body composition, causing increased body fat and decreased muscle mass. Additionally, children with GH deficiency may experience delayed puberty and other metabolic issues. Early diagnosis and treatment with GH therapy can help mitigate these effects and promote normal growth and development.

Is tetany caused by hyposecretion of the thyroid?

No, tetany is not typically caused by hyposecretion of the thyroid. Tetany is usually associated with low levels of calcium in the blood, which can be caused by factors such as hypoparathyroidism or vitamin D deficiency. Hypothyroidism, on the other hand, results from the underproduction of thyroid hormones by the thyroid gland.

Hyposecretion of the follicle-stimulating hormone can cause?

Hyposecretion of the follicle-stimulating hormone can cause issues with reproductive health, such as infertility, irregular menstrual cycles, and problems with sperm production in men. It may also affect the development and maturation of eggs in women.
